Job Description
As an Inventory Assistant, you will be responsible for supporting three non-chemical stockrooms on a research campus. This position focuses on maintaining appropriate inventory levels, fulfilling internal orders, and ensuring stockrooms remain clean, safe, and fully operational.
Key Responsibilities Include
- Pulling and assembling orders based on stockroom and researcher needs
- Monitoring inventory levels to minimize overstock while preventing stockouts
- Verifying receipt of orders and accurately putting away inventory
- Maintaining organized shelves and updating inventory records and documentation
- Processing returns, requesting supplier credits, and tracking backordered items
- Coordinating with vendors, internal customers, and team members via email and in person
- Supporting ongoing projects and day-to-day operational tasks as they arise
- Ensuring all stockroom locations meet safety, cleanliness, and organizational standards
This role requires strong attention to detail, follow-through, and a customer-focused mindset in a fast-paced, hands-on environment.
